




Living near Boston College
Boston College, located in charming Chestnut Hill, is a desirable area to live, thanks to its stellar reputation, gorgeous Gothic architecture, and immaculate landscaping. Situated between residential Newton and more urban neighborhoods on the edge of Boston, apartments near Boston College span the full range from affordable to luxury.
In Chestnut Hill, most apartments are well-appointed, modern, and spacious, with high-end price tags to match. Living in Chestnut Hill also provides access to excellent school districts, a plus for renters with young families.
While Chestnut Hill and some parts of neighboring Brookline may be pricey for college students, there are areas within Brookline and other neighborhoods near Boston College that appeal to students and the budget-conscious. For example, reasonably-priced apartments near Boston College can be found in Allston and Brighton. From here, whether renting a studio apartment or sharing a house with roommates, you can easily navigate the Boston area, either via the Commonwealth Ave branch of the Green Line or the MBTA bus system. While many streets offer residential permit parking, plenty of residents rely solely on public transportation to get around.
Living in an apartment near Boston College not only provides easy access to campus, but it also puts you just a stone’s throw away from several museums and historical houses, including the Mary Baker Eddy House and the Waterworks Museum. The Shops at Chestnut Hill are a destination for upscale shopping, while Allston and Brighton provide a vibrant array of restaurants, bars, comfort food, and every type of eatery in between.
